The Lyons Inquiry into local government:
delivering devolution?

This paper first sets out the Lyons Inquiry’s headline conclusions, focusing on the short-term ‘quick wins’ that could help to stabilise the local government finance system and re-build confidence in local taxation and local stewardship of resources. Second, it examines the Government’s immediate reaction – and what will happen next.
